Jason Wu, Louis Vuitton Inspire Decor at Fashion for Paws

D. Channing Muller
April 16, 2013

Syzygy Events International returned as the visionaries behind the staging and decor for the Washington Humane Society’s Fashion for Paws fund-raiser on Saturday night. The team aimed for a completely different look at the National Building Museum than last year’s flower-filled fete, opting for a more modern look with emerald accents—in honor of the color’s designation as color of the year.

Designers Marielle Shortell and Julie Shanklin took inspiration from fashion designers Jason Wu's and Louis Vuitton’s 2013 spring collections with sleek, black and white decor with checkered details. Combining their efforts with Atmosphere Lighting, rentals from Design Cuisine—who also catered the dinner—and minimalistic-style floral centerpieces from Edge Floral Event Designers, the 1,700-person event transformed the museum and raised about $700,000.

Each of the 70 models who walked the runway with a four-legged friend raised at least $5,000 for the Washington Humane Society. The top individual fund-raiser brought in $37,000.

Syzygy Events International took inspiration from Jason Wu's black and white spring 2013 show and the checkered pattern of Louis Vuitton when it came to designing this year's stage and runway. Three rows of Edison lights flanked the checkered wall in an homage to the glitz of the Grammys stage. The team created a circular runway with models stopping at every quarter mark as they made their way around to pose for photographers and supporters at the dinner tables.

Syzygy worked with Atmosphere Lighting to bring a pop of emerald green to the black and white staging with green uplights along the museum's signature columns as well as additional gobos on the green draping above the main stage with the event's signature 'F4P' logo.

The black and white decor extended off the stage to highboys draped in striped linens with black chairs. The tables provided seating for general admission ticket holders who did not purchase V.I.P. dinner seats.

Edge Floral Event Designers kept the centerpieces minimalistic with simple arrangements of white hydrangea or floating flower petals and votives in clear vases. Georgetown Cupcake's individually wrapped cupcakes in signature pink pastry boxes added a pop of color to the tables. During the weeks leading up to the event, the bakery donated a portion of sales from its 'pupcake' cupcake to the organization.

The Aba Agency produced the show, which showcased fashions from Tysons Galleria retailers like Lilly Pulitzer, Karen Millen, and Nicole Miller. Canine company Wagtime provided matching accessories and outfits for the dogs walking in the show.
